Preguntas frecuentes acerca de apartamentos baratos en Oakwood

¿Cuál es el precio de un apartamento barato en Oakwood?

El apartamento más barato en Oakwood es Woodside Court que está listado en $3,095, mientras que el apartamento promedio en Oakwood cuesta $3,604.

¿Qué tipos de apartamentos son los más baratos en Oakwood?

Los apartamentos para estudiantes, para personas de bajos ingresos y por habitaciones suelen ser los alquileres más baratos en la mayoría de las ciudades, aunque requieren criterios de calificación para alquilarlos. Hay 5 apartamentos normales en Oakwood que creemos que califican como 'apartamentos baratos' que no tienen requisitos especiales para solicitar el alquiler.
